一种河流表面平均流速测量装置及方法制造方法及图纸

技术编号:15636611 阅读:76 留言:0更新日期:2017-06-14 20:29
本发明专利技术提供一种测量河流表面的平均流速的方法和系统,所述方法包括:基于当前时刻和前一时刻的河流表面图像,获得当前时刻的河流表面图像的运动显著性点或运动显著性区域;基于一定时间内每一时刻的运动显著性点或运动显著性区域,获得一定时间内的平均位移;以及基于比尺标定系数、所述一定时间内的平均位移以及帧间时间,获得一定时间内的平均流速。本发明专利技术不需要在水面投掷浮标,且可持续流速测量流速。

【技术实现步骤摘要】
一种河流表面平均流速测量装置及方法
本专利技术涉及图像处理领域,更具体地,涉及河流表面平均流速测量装置及方法。
技术介绍
我国的河流众多,对于河流的综合利用,一直占据着我国国家经济与社会发展的重要地位。水文监测信息对预防治理洪涝和水旱灾害以及水资源调控具有重要作用。而流速测量是水文监测的重要工作之一,但是目前的流速测量方法用方面都有一定的局限性。常用的河水流速测量方法主要分为3类。第一类是传统的流速仪测量法,其主要原理是通过水流带动旋桨转动,记录旋桨转速,通过一定的映射关系可算出流速,但存在着当水质突变,含沙量变大时误差会变大,且水中漂浮物会影响其结果甚至损毁旋浆的问题。第二类是通过声学多普勒效应来测量流速,主要用于测量船,也存在着设备和人类投入比较大,成本比较高的问题。第三类是基于视频处理与浮标法结合的水流速度测量方法,频中浮标的运动轨迹结合摄像机标定来计算水流速度。第三类方法的两个例子是:(1)专利技术专利“大范围表面流速长的图像处理系统及其同步实时测量方法”(申请号CN1289037A,2000年),(2)“基于视频处理的河水流速监测系统设计”(韩予皖,太原理工大学硕士论文,2010年)。两个例子均使用了浮标法与图像处理相结合的方案,在使用时需要投入浮标,然后在视频中跟踪浮标或示踪粒子的运动。这两个例子中,采用的跟踪原理都基于浮标与水面在颜色上有明显不同,以水面为背景,浮标为跟踪目标。但该方法需要向摄像机视场中投掷浮标,当浮标漂出摄像机的视场后,就无法检测流速,无法实现对水流速度的不间断实时测量;同时浮标的投掷和回收也是很麻烦的事情。
技术实现思路
本专利技术提供一种克服上述问题或者至少部分地解决上述问题的河流表面平均流速测量装置及方法。根据本专利技术的一个方面,提供一种测量河流表面的平均流速的方法,包括:S1、基于当前时刻和前一时刻的河流表面图像,获得当前时刻的河流表面图像的运动显著性点或运动显著性区域;S2、基于一定时间内每一时刻的运动显著性点或运动显著性区域,获得一定时间内的平均位移;以及S3、基于比尺标定系数、所述一定时间内的平均位移以及帧间时间,获得一定时间内的平均流速。根据本专利技术的另一个方面,还提供一种测量河流表面平均流速的系统,包括:运动显著性检测装置,用于基于当前时刻和前一时刻的河流表面图像,获得当前时刻的河流表面图像的运动显著性点或运动显著性区域;平均位移检测装置,与所述运动显著性检测装置连接,基于一定时间内每一时刻的运动显著性点或运动显著性区域,获得一定时间内的平均位移;以及平均流速检测装置,与所述平均位移检测装置连接,所述平均流速检测装置用于基于比尺标定系数和一定时间内每个时刻的平均位移以及帧间时间,获得一定时间内的平均流速。本申请通过垂直于水面的摄像头获取河流视频,分析其中具有显著运动性的特征图,提取出其中的运动显著性区域或运动显著性点,跟踪各运动显著性区域或运动显著性点对应的位移,联立图像坐标系和与现实空间坐标系的位置映射关系以及帧间时间计算出河流表面实际流速。本申请不需要在水面投掷浮标,而是能利用河水流动过程中本身产生的波动纹理特征或自然漂浮物来测量河流表面平均流速的、且可持续流速测量流速。附图说明图1为根据本专利技术实施例的一种测量河流表面的平均流速的方法流程图;图2为根据本专利技术实施例的测量河流表面的平均流速的方法的直方图;图3为根据本专利技术实施例的测量河流表面平均流速的系统的结构框图。具体实施方式下面结合附图和实施例,对本专利技术的具体实施方式作进一步详细描述。以下实施例用于说明本专利技术,但不用来限制本专利技术的范围。为了克服现有技术中需要在水面上投掷浮标,导致的当浮标漂出摄像机的视场后无法检测流速的问题,以及投掷及回收麻烦的问题,本专利技术提供了一种利用河水流动过程中本身产生的波动纹理特征或自然漂浮物来测量河流表面平均流速的、且可持续流速测量流速的方法。图1示出了根据本专利技术实施例的一种测量河流表面的平均流速的方法流程图,包括:S1、基于当前时刻和前一时刻的河流表面图像,获得当前时刻的河流表面图像的运动显著性点或运动显著性区域;S2、基于一定时间内每一时刻的运动显著性点或运动显著性区域,获得一定时间内的平均位移;以及S3、基于比尺标定系数、所述一定时间内的平均位移以及帧间时间,获得一定时间内的平均流速。本专利技术通过垂直于水面的摄像头获取河流视频(序列图像),分析其中具有显著运动性的特征图,提取出其中的运动显著性特征点,跟踪各运动显著性特征点对应的像素位移,联立图像坐标系和与现实空间坐标系的位置映射关系以及帧间时间计算出河流表面实际流速。在一个实施例中,本专利技术提供了一种基于运动显著性区域获得平均位移的方法,其中,所述步骤S1包括:S1.1、基于t时刻的河流表面图像Pt和t-1时刻的河流表面图像Pt-1的帧差,获得t时刻的运动显著性特征图xt。同理,基于t+1时刻的河流表面图像Pt+1和t时刻的河流表面图像Pt,获得t+1时刻的运动显著性特征图xt+1。帧差,也称之为帧间差分,是一种通过对视频图像序列中相邻两帧作差分运算来获得运动目标轮廓的方法,它可以很好地适用于存在多个运动目标和摄像机移动的情况。当监控场景中出现异常物体运动时,帧与帧之间会出现较为明显的差别,两帧相减,得到两帧图像亮度差的绝对值,判断它是否大于阈值来分析视频或图像序列的运动特性,确定图像序列中有无物体运动。S1.2、基于所述当前时刻的运动显著性特征图,获得当前时刻的河流表面图像的运动显著性区域。在一个实施例中,所述步骤S1.2包括:S1.2.1、将t时刻的运动显著性特征图二值化,获得二值图。图像的二值化,就是将图像上的像素点的灰度值设置为0或255,也就是将整个图像呈现出明显的只有黑和白的视觉效果。最常用的方法就是设定一个阈值T,用T将图像的数据分成两部分:大于T的像素群和小于T的像素群。S1.2.2、在所述二值图上选取Nt,1个连通域,任意一个所述连通域为长度或宽度为20-100像素点的矩形。二值图像分析最重要的方法就是连通区域标记,它是所有二值图像分析的基础,它通过对二值图像中白色像素(目标)的标记,让每个单独的连通区域形成一个被标识的块,即为连通域。S1.2.3、将所述连通域作为蒙版,蒙版就是选框的外部(选框的内部就是选区),查找t时刻的运动显著性特征图中对应所述连通域的位置,作为所述运动显著性区域,这些运动显著性区域的集合记为{ft,i}(i=1,2,…,Nt,1|t=1,2,…)。在一个实施例中,所述二值化的阈值为所述运动显著性特征图的灰度最大值的0.9倍。在一个实施例中,所述步骤S2包括:S2.1、在t时刻的显著性特征图中搜索与t-1时刻的每个运动显著性区域匹配的匹配区域;S2.2、计算所述匹配区域在t-1时刻至t时刻在运动显著性特征图中相对位移;以及S2.3、基于一定时间内每一时刻对应的匹配区域的相对位移,获得相对位移的直方图,对所述直方图内峰值以及峰值附近一定范围的区域的值的平均值,作为所述一定时间内的平均位移。对于一个模板ft,i,若能在运动显著性特征图xt+1中搜索到其匹配区域,计算该匹配区域坐标与ft,i在xt中坐标的相对位移,若所有在xt+1中能找到匹配区域的模板个数为Nt,2,则得到各运动显著性区域的本文档来自技高网...
一种河流表面平均流速测量装置及方法

【技术保护点】
一种测量河流表面的平均流速的方法,其特征在于,包括:S1、基于当前时刻和前一时刻的河流表面图像,获得当前时刻的河流表面图像的运动显著性点或运动显著性区域;S2、基于一定时间内每一时刻的运动显著性点或运动显著性区域,获得一定时间内的平均位移;以及S3、基于比尺标定系数、所述一定时间内的平均位移以及帧间时间,获得一定时间内的平均流速。

【技术特征摘要】
1.一种测量河流表面的平均流速的方法,其特征在于,包括:S1、基于当前时刻和前一时刻的河流表面图像,获得当前时刻的河流表面图像的运动显著性点或运动显著性区域;S2、基于一定时间内每一时刻的运动显著性点或运动显著性区域,获得一定时间内的平均位移;以及S3、基于比尺标定系数、所述一定时间内的平均位移以及帧间时间,获得一定时间内的平均流速。2.如权利要求1所述的测量河流表面平均流速的方法,其特征在于,所述步骤S1包括:S1.1、基于当前时刻和前一时刻的河流表面图像的帧差,获得当前时刻的运动显著性特征图;以及S1.2、基于所述当前时刻的运动显著性特征图,获得当前时刻的河流表面图像的运动显著性区域。3.如权利要求2所述的测量河流表面平均流速的方法,其特征在于,所述步骤S1.2包括:S1.2.1、将当前时刻的运动显著性特征图二值化,获得二值图;S1.2.2、在所述二值图上选取若干个连通域,任意一个所述连通域为长度或宽度为20-100像素点的矩形;以及S1.2.3、将所述连通域作为蒙版,查找当前时刻的运动显著性特征图中对应所述连通域的位置,作为所述运动显著性区域。4.如权利要求3所述的测量河流表面平均流速的方法,其特征在于,所述步骤S2包括:S2.1、在当前时刻的显著性特征图中搜索与前一时刻的每个运动显著性区域匹配的匹配区域;S2.2、计算所述匹配区域在前一时刻至当前时刻在运动显著性特征图中相对位移;以及S2.3、基于一定时间内每一时刻对应的匹配区域的相对位移,获得相对位移的直方图,对所述直方图内峰值以及峰值附近一定范围的区域的值的平均值,作为所述一定时间内的平均位移。5.如权利要求1所述的测量河流表面平均流速的方法,其特征在于,所述步骤S1包括:S1.1、基于当前时刻和前一时刻的河流表面图像的帧差,获得当前时刻的运动显著性特征图;S1.2、基于角点检测法,检测所述运动显著性特征图中的关键点,获得该时刻的所述运动显著性点。6.如权利要求5所述的测量河流表面平均流速的方法,其特征在于,所述步骤S2包括:S2.1、对一定时间内每个时刻的运动显著性特征图中所述运动显著性点的sift特征,从当前时刻的运动...

【专利技术属性】
技术研发人员:冯全
申请(专利权)人:甘肃农业大学
类型:发明
国别省市:甘肃,62

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1